Stock investing is lucrative and great for earning passive income via dividends. This helps supplement your retirement income or paycheck. Many stocks trade publicly on major stock exchanges, which makes them easier to sell and buy. While putting your money in stocks can be lucrative, it’s also risky. However, implementing the right tactics can help minimize risk and ensure success. Discussed below are four stock investment tips for beginners.

1. Prioritize stock valuation

Stock valuation is a critical step when investing in stocks as it helps you determine a stock’s intrinsic value by assessing relevant factors such as market trends and financial statements. It’s a vital tool that enables you to:

  • Make informed decisions regarding selling or buying stocks by determining whether a stock is undervalued, overvalued, or reasonably priced
  • Manage risks by spotting stocks that could be susceptible to substantial price fluctuations
  • Identify reliable companies with sustainable growth potential, which is crucial for long-term investing
  • Compare various stocks in the same sector or industry to determine which companies are a better investment

2. Set stock investment goals

Investment goals are key to helping you remain motivated and focused. They enable you to determine your long-term, medium-term, and short-term financial objectives. Setting investment goals provides purpose and structure to the funds you allocate to stocks. Your stock investment goals may include:

  • Raising a house purchase deposit
  • Buying investment properties
  • Amassing funds for education funding
  • Building retirement wealth
  • Achieving financial independence and more

Also, your investment goals should be SMART (specific, measurable, attainable, realistic, and time-bound), ensuring your objectives can be achieved within a particular time frame.

3. Learn how to manage stock investing risks

The unpredictable nature of the stock market and the numerous factors that impact the whole market’s or a specific stock’s performance make stock investing quite risky. Learning how to manage stock investing risks can help you keep potential losses in check while enabling you to navigate the uncertain world of the stock market more confidently. Some of the best ways to manage risks include:

  • Research and analysis: Conducting in-depth research and study can help determine the risks associated with particular sectors or stocks. Technical and fundamental analysis can help you make informed investing decisions
  • Stop-loss orders: Applying stop-loss orders lets you set predetermined prices at which your stock should automatically sell
  • Position sizing: It involves determining a suitable investment amount depending on your risk tolerance to avoid being overly exposed to any specific stock. This limits potential losses

4. Choose an investment strategy

An investment strategy directs your investing decisions based on your risk tolerance, investment goals, and future capital needs. A well-defined stock investment technique enables you to remain focused and disciplined while reducing the risk of being influenced by short-term market changes. It also allows for better risk management. Some of the stock investing strategies you can explore include:

  • Buy and hold: It involves buying and holding onto stocks until their values grow before selling
  • Value investing: It involves purchasing stocks with a lot of value below or at their actual value
  • Growth investing: It includes buying stocks in rapidly growing sectors

Dollar-cost averaging and momentum investing are other strategies to consider.
